Here are some the most common but major mistakes a taxpayer does:

Doing the arithmetic incorrectly. Ready that calculator out and never ever do the costs without assistance from the tool. Save your time and do the math correct so the process can be as smooth as silk. Check the figures, have it go through a different pair of careful eyes.

Incorrect status. Some people have a tendency to lie about their statuses to spare discounts. Others might have been capable of getting away with this, but what happens if you’re one of those who are unlucky?Easy. Simply be prepared to confront your consequence and pay for a heavier price by means of a fine. Be honest.

Unknown deductions. Reduce tax payments by knowing what certain deductions apply to you. Ask about it from the people who spent years in dealing with taxes. With the ever changing tax laws, one can never be that knowledgeable with everything, so it is very important to be one of the people who are rightfully informed.

Forgetting charity works. Failing to contribute some of the abandoned items one has is among the common mistakes taxpayers do. Plan a specific time each year where you get to bring back to the society, but don’t forget to request a receipt! It won’t only offer you a return, it may also keep your abode a space, and most importantly, give you a unique type of joy.

Filing errors. Wrong social security numbers, addresses, or failing to use the right tax table will not only result to the delay of the entire process, it will also automatically enable the IRS to reject your deductions and credits. That’s why, when filling in information, make sure to write legibly and accurately to avoid future problems.

Cramming. This is possibly the most typical but most avoidable error of a taxpayer. Don’t wait until March for tax preparation. Be ready as soon as you can. Stay away from unwanted feelings of anxiety and worries. Get ready and you will see yourself reaping the seeds of your effort in no time.
